22 ·How terrible it will be for people [L Woe to those] who are ·famous for [heroes/champions at] drinking wine
    and are ·champions [valiant men] at mixing ·drinks [beer; v. 11].
23 They take ·money [a bribe] to ·set the guilty free [acquit the wicked]
    and ·don’t allow good people to be judged fairly [deny justice/righteousness to the innocent/righteous].
24 [L Therefore] They will be destroyed
    just as ·fire [L tongues of fire] ·burns [L devours] straw
    and dry grass ·is consumed by [L sinks in the] flames.
They will be destroyed
    like a plant whose roots rot
    and whose flower dies and blows away like dust.
They have ·refused to obey [rejected; spurned] the ·teachings [law; L Torah] of the Lord ·All-Powerful [Almighty; of Heaven’s Armies; T of hosts]
    and have ·hated [despised] the message from the Holy One of Israel [1:4].
